IJCOf <br />N�EW Report Number 14 -034 <br />)N Agenda Section VI -5 <br />tme city that wnrkv For you Council Meeting Date February 11, 2014 <br />REQUEST FOR COUNCIL CONSIDERATION <br />ITEM DESCRIPTION: AUTHORIZATION TO PURCHASE A 2014 Ford F -150 4 X 2 TRUCK <br />WITH 8' Box <br />DEPARTMENT HEAD'S APPROVAL: Sandy Breuer, Dire of P s and Recreation <br />CITY MANAGER'S APPROVAL: Dean Lot er <br />No comments to supplement this repo t Comments attached <br />Recommendation: Authorize entering into an agreement with Midway Ford Commercial to purchase a <br />new 2014 Ford F -150 4 X 2 Truck with 8' box for replacement of City Vehicle #015, a Dodge purchased <br />in 2001. <br />Financial Impact: This truck will be purchased under Minnesota State bid. The cost of the vehicle is as <br />follows: <br />Contract #54363 <br />Vehicle Price $15,573.92 <br />Options $ 1,706.00 <br />Sub -Total $17,279.92 <br />Sales Tax (6.5 %) $ 1,123.19 <br />Total Price of Vehicle $18,403.11 <br />Graphics /Light Bar /Bed liner Approx. $ 1,000.00 <br />Vehicle w /equipment $19,403.11 <br />Expected Sale Value of #976 $ 2,700 <br />Total Price after Sale of #976 <br />The Parks Department has an "unfunded/pooled" vehicle #976 (1997 Chevy %2 ton pickup) that is not on <br />the fleet replacement plan. This vehicle is used in the summer to help with the transportation and work <br />projects of our summer staff and to haul the brine tank for Public Works in the winter. It is staffs <br />recommendation to sell vehicle #976 at auction and move vehicle #015 to the "unfunded/pooled" vehicle <br />to serve those needs. <br />Explanation: The purpose of this report is to obtain Council authorization to purchase a 2014 Ford F- <br />150 4 X 2 with 8' box. This vehicle will be used by the Parks Department for transporting personnel, <br />equipment, and materials to various job sites. This vehicle is scheduled for replacement on a 10 -year <br />cycle. The new vehicle will replace Vehicle #015 a Dodge pickup purchased in 2001 which was <br />scheduled to be replaced in 2011. <br />Costs and Funding: The Park Fleet Replacement Plan has $20,000 planned for the replacement of this <br />vehicle. <br />
